The Covid-19 quarantine has prevented many beloved pastimes and activities. Sophomores of Dakota Ridge, however, have found a way to keep themselves busy and entertained while staying safe.
Karis Fridgen escapes her troubles with a pair of sneakers and fresh air to achieve cross country goals. “It definitely helps with all the stress that’s going on right now. It kinda just clears my mind, and it helps me get out of the house, and I know I’m being safe just by myself,” Fridgen said.
